According
to TechSci Research report, “Asia-Pacific
Electric Construction and Agriculture Equipment Market – By Country, Competition, Forecast and Opportunities, 2020-2030F”, The
Asia-Pacific Electric Construction and Agriculture Equipment Market was valued
at USD 1.85 Billion in 2024 and is expected to reach USD 5.89 Billion by 2030
with a CAGR of 21.11% during the forecast period. The Asia-Pacific region is
witnessing a significant uptick in the adoption of compact electric
construction equipment, particularly in urban areas where space constraints and
environmental regulations are stringent. Compact electric machinery, such as mini-excavators
and loaders with battery capacities under 50 kWh, are increasingly favored for
their maneuverability, reduced noise levels, and zero emissions. These features
make them ideal for operations in densely populated cities and indoor
construction sites.
The
demand for such equipment is further propelled by the need for sustainable
construction practices and the push towards reducing the carbon footprint of
urban development projects. Manufacturers are responding by expanding their
portfolios to include more compact electric models, catering to the growing
market segment that prioritizes environmental compliance and operational
efficiency.
Agricultural
practices in the Asia-Pacific are rapidly evolving with the integration of
advanced technologies such as the Internet of Things (IoT), Artificial
Intelligence (AI), and robotics. These technologies enable precision farming,
allowing for real-time monitoring of crop health, soil conditions, and
equipment performance. The adoption of IoT-enabled electric tractors and
harvesters is enhancing productivity and resource efficiency, particularly in
countries like Australia, where ag-tech investments reached USD253 million in
2023.
This
technological shift is not only improving yield outcomes but also attracting
younger generations to farming by transforming it into a high-tech industry.
The trend is expected to continue as governments and private sectors invest in
smart agriculture initiatives to ensure food security and sustainable farming
practices.

Based
on equipment type, agriculture equipment is the fastest growing segment in the Asia-Pacific
Electric Construction and Agriculture Equipment market during the forecast
period, due to several key factors. A major driver of growth in this sector is
the rising need for sustainability and environmental regulations. Governments
across the Asia-Pacific region, particularly in countries like China, India,
and Japan, are increasingly focused on reducing the carbon footprint of
agricultural practices. Electric agricultural equipment, such as electric
tractors, harvesters, and tillers, offer a viable alternative to traditional
fuel-powered machines by reducing emissions and promoting eco-friendly farming
practices.
Moreover,
the rapid technological advancements in battery performance and energy
efficiency are driving the adoption of electric equipment in agriculture. With
improved battery life, faster charging times, and reduced operational costs,
electric machinery is becoming more practical and cost-effective for farmers.
Innovations in autonomous and precision farming technologies are also playing a
key role in making electric equipment more appealing. These technologies
enhance operational efficiency by enabling precise control over planting,
irrigation, and harvesting, reducing labor costs and increasing productivity.
Additionally,
labor shortages in agriculture, particularly in countries like Japan and South
Korea, are encouraging farmers to adopt automation and electric-powered
machines that require less human intervention. These solutions not only address
the issue of labor scarcity but also reduce the dependency on fossil fuels,
providing a cleaner and more efficient way to manage agricultural tasks.
The
growing trend toward smart farming is another contributing factor. With
increasing interest in digital tools and IoT technologies, electric
agricultural equipment is becoming integral to modern farming practices.
Governments are also offering subsidies and financial incentives to promote the
use of electric equipment, further accelerating the market growth.
As
these factors continue to converge, the agriculture equipment segment in the
Asia-Pacific Electric Construction and Agriculture Equipment market is expected
to experience significant growth throughout the forecast period.
Based
on country, India is the fastest growing country in the Asia-Pacific Electric
Construction and Agriculture Equipment Market during the forecast period due to
a combination of government support, rising demand for sustainable solutions,
and technological advancements in electric equipment. Government Policies and
Regulations play a significant role in driving India’s growth in this sector.
The Indian government has set ambitious sustainability targets, including its
goal of achieving net-zero emissions by 2070. To support this, the government
has implemented various incentives and subsidies for electric equipment,
particularly in the construction and agriculture sectors. Initiatives like the FAME
India Scheme (Faster Adoption and Manufacturing of Hybrid and Electric
Vehicles) encourage the adoption of electric machinery, making it an attractive
proposition for local businesses and farmers. Additionally, government schemes
targeting smart agriculture and urban infrastructure projects are pushing for
greener, more efficient construction and farming technologies.
India’s
rapid urbanization and large-scale infrastructure development are contributing
to the increased demand for electric construction equipment. The need for eco-friendly
machinery in urban projects, such as electric excavators, cranes, and loaders,
is growing to comply with stricter environmental regulations in major cities
like Delhi, Mumbai, and Bengaluru. Moreover, the availability of affordable and
efficient electric solutions is making it easier for companies in the
construction sector to adopt these technologies.
In
the agriculture sector, India is experiencing significant shifts toward smart
farming and precision agriculture. As labor shortages and environmental
concerns intensify, electric-powered machinery, such as tractors and
harvesters, are seen as ideal solutions to increase efficiency while reducing
dependency on fossil fuels. With the government's push for digital farming and
automation, demand for electric agricultural equipment is expected to surge.
India’s
growing local manufacturing base for electric machinery and its position as a
hub for innovation and research in electric technology further strengthens its
role in the region’s electric equipment market. These factors combine to
position India as a leading player in the Asia-Pacific Electric Construction
and Agriculture Equipment market.
